Environmental health officers are responsible for monitoring and assessing environmental factors that can impact public health, such as air and water quality, food safety, and waste management. They also investigate potential health hazards, enforce regulations, and work to prevent and control environmental health risks in communities.
An Environmental Impact Statement is required by companies when starting a factory or making a change to the manufacturing processes. It is meant to outline what impact the change will have on the environment.

The environmental impact of plywood production includes deforestation, energy consumption, and emissions of volatile organic compounds during manufacturing. However, plywood is often more sustainable than solid wood because it makes more efficient use of timber resources and can be made from fast-growing or plantation-grown trees. Proper sourcing and production practices can help mitigate its environmental impact.

The environmental impact of cheese production and consumption includes greenhouse gas emissions from livestock, deforestation for grazing land, water pollution from dairy farms, and energy use in processing and transportation.
Algae play a crucial role in the food processing industry as a source of natural ingredients, including thickeners, stabilizers, and emulsifiers, such as agar and carrageenan. They are rich in nutrients, offering health benefits such as antioxidants, vitamins, and minerals, which are increasingly valued in health-conscious consumer markets. Additionally, algae can enhance the sustainability of food production by providing alternatives to animal-derived products and reducing the environmental impact of food processing. Their versatility and nutritional profile make them an essential component in developing innovative food products.
Food miles is a term which refers to the distance food is transported from the time of its production until it reaches the consumer. Food miles are one factor used when assessing the environmental impact of food, including the impact on global warming

The industrial food chain refers to the large-scale production, processing, and distribution of food that is heavily reliant on technology, mechanization, and globalization. It typically involves a series of stages, including farming, processing, packaging, and transportation, often prioritizing efficiency and cost-effectiveness over sustainability and local sourcing. This system is characterized by monoculture farming, the use of synthetic fertilizers and pesticides, and centralized distribution networks. While it can produce food at lower prices, it raises concerns about environmental impact, food quality, and the well-being of workers and communities involved.

Slop bins are containers used for collecting and storing organic waste, particularly in agricultural or food processing contexts. They are designed to hold leftover food, scraps, and other biodegradable materials, which can later be processed for composting or feed for livestock. Slop bins help manage waste efficiently and reduce environmental impact by promoting recycling and composting practices.
